In this episode, I talk about approaching your strength training with intent and focus, the value of low-rep training for making insane strength gains and I share the format from a strength class at Myodetox Performance. As a bonus, I address the topic of frequency, volume and intensity and how to manipulate each factor to create the most realistic and sustainable training program to crush your goals!
